Why Fire Damage Restoration Businesses Need a Dedicated CRM
Fire damage restoration is an emergency-response, insurance-driven business built almost entirely around speed and documentation — a customer calling after a fire needs a board-up and structural assessment within hours, not days, and the entire job that follows will likely be paid through an insurance claim that lives or dies on the quality of documentation captured from the very first visit. A company that's slow to respond loses the job to a faster competitor; a company that documents poorly gets a customer stuck fighting their insurer over a denied or reduced claim.
The work itself spans structural assessment, smoke and soot remediation, odor removal, and often coordination with contractors for reconstruction — meaning a fire restoration job frequently isn't a single service but a multi-phase project that needs the same kind of project-tracking sophistication as a construction job, layered on top of the emergency-response urgency of the first 24 hours.
The Fire Damage Restoration Market Landscape
Fire damage restoration is one of the most insurance-dependent trades in home services — the overwhelming majority of jobs are paid through a homeowner's insurance policy, and companies that build direct billing relationships with insurance carriers and adjusters have a significant competitive advantage over those requiring customers to pay upfront and seek reimbursement themselves. IICRC certification (specifically fire and smoke restoration credentials) is the industry-recognized standard adjusters look for when approving a vendor. Demand is inherently unpredictable and emergency-driven rather than seasonal or schedulable, meaning the businesses that win are structured for 24/7 intake and rapid first-response, not standard business-hours scheduling.
The Biggest Challenges Facing Fire Damage Restoration Businesses
Every fire damage restoration business owner knows these pain points. Here's how they hold your company back — and why a purpose-built CRM is the only real fix.
True 24/7 Emergency Response Requirement
Fires don't happen on a schedule, and a homeowner or business owner standing outside a smoke-damaged property at 2 AM needs a response immediately — not a callback at 9 AM. Companies without genuine after-hours intake and dispatch capability lose these jobs entirely to competitors who can mobilize immediately.
Insurance Claim Documentation From the First Visit
The initial assessment visit needs to capture the documentation — photos, damage scope, cause assessment — that will support an insurance claim potentially worth tens of thousands of dollars. Incomplete or poorly organized documentation from that first visit can mean a customer's claim gets underpaid or disputed months later, long after the moment to capture better evidence has passed.
Multi-Phase Project Coordination
A fire restoration job typically moves through board-up, structural assessment, smoke/soot remediation, odor treatment, and often reconstruction — sometimes involving subcontracted trades. Without a system tracking the full project across these phases, coordination falls apart and customers are left without clear visibility into a process that's already emotionally difficult.
Direct Insurance Billing Relationships
Companies that can bill insurance carriers directly, rather than requiring customers to pay out of pocket and seek reimbursement, win more jobs and create less financial stress for customers already dealing with a traumatic loss. Building and maintaining those carrier relationships requires organized, adjuster-ready documentation as a baseline requirement.
Smoke Odor Remediation Complexity
Smoke odor can persist in materials long after visible damage is addressed, and customers who experience lingering odor after a job is marked "complete" become disputes and negative reviews. Systematic post-remediation odor verification protects against that outcome.
Emotional, High-Stress Customer Communication
Fire damage customers are often dealing with a genuinely traumatic loss, sometimes including displacement from their home. Communication that's too transactional or too slow compounds an already stressful situation, and companies that handle this relationship with more care differentiate meaningfully in a business built on referrals and reviews from people in crisis.
